function encodeCrockfordBase32(bytes: Uint8Array): string {
let bits = 0
let value = 0
let output = ''
for (const byte of bytes) {
value = (value << 8) | byte
bits += 8
while (bits >= 5) {
output += CROCKFORD_BASE32_ALPHABET[(value >>> (bits - 5)) & 31] || ''
bits -= 5
}
}
if (bits > 0) {
output += CROCKFORD_BASE32_ALPHABET[(value << (5 - bits)) & 31] || ''
}
return output
}
